Job Description :
Job Announcement Position Information Position Title Cheerleading Coordinator Campus Cranford Department Athletics Full-time, Part-time, Adjunct Part Time Exempt or Non-Exempt Non-Exempt Regular,Temporary, or Grant Regular General Description The Cheerleading Coordinator has primary responsibility to provide oversight, leadership, expertise and promotes campus-wide spirit initiatives as well as direct the cheerleading team. Characteristics, Duties, and Responsibilities • Directs and supervises activities such as practices and workouts and prepare participants for sideline and college events. • Promotes school spirit in college and community. • Informs the Director of Athletics any spirit/sideline team concerns. • Incorporates cheer, dance and stunts into sideline and dead ball/time outs during events. • Informs the Director of Athletics and Athletic Trainer of any issues affecting athlete's performance such as injuries, discipline, positives, needs, etc. • Recommends items needed for sideline events (uniforms, fan gear, etc.) • Promotes student body involvement at events. • Coordinates with coaches for various activities (decorating locker rooms, assist with college events, pep assemblies, etc.) • Assists in providing leadership programming and services learning opportunities for students. • Maintains social aspects of participants (social media, code of conduct, as well as appropriate behavior in uniform, etc.) • Reflects a positive image for the team and UCNJ Union College of Union County, NJ, both on and off the playing arena. Ensures that the members of the team conduct themselves with a high degree of moral integrity as representatives of UCNJ at all public appearances whether on or off campus. • Fosters an environment that supports and encourages each student-athlete to graduate within the two-year window, including monitoring the attendance in the ALC as is required by all student-athletes. • Shows strong initiative and desire to work in a highly collaborative environment. • Perform administrative and oversite duties for Cheer Squad including, updating safety protocols, and completing any form necessary to make sure the program is in compliance with college protocol. • Schedule and overseeing Cheer Squad try-outs, including instruction and judging. • Coordinate and be present at all games that the Cheer Squad will attend. Education Requirements Bachelor's degree Required with Cheer Experience and/or Cheer Certification. Experience • 3 years coaching or teaching experience with knowledge of Pep Squad, Cheer, and/or Dance strongly preferred. Competencies and Skills Required • Valid driver's license and clean driving record required. • Good communication and interpersonal skills. Physical Demands and Work Environment • This position's duties are normally performed in a typical interior/residence work environment or inside a gymnasium work environment, based on the activity scheduled. • Some physical effort required; however, the employee must occasionally lift and/or move up to 25 pounds. • No or very limited exposure to physical risk. • Some travel required.
